The Pressure of Following Pat Sajak
For over 40 years, Pat Sajak had been the face of Wheel of Fortune. His wit, charm, and timeless presence made him a household name, and when he announced his departure from the show, many fans were left wondering who could possibly step into his shoes. The pressure was on as Wheel of Fortune producers sought a new host to carry on the legacy. Enter Ryan Seacrest.
Seacrest, who had already cemented his status as a television powerhouse with his roles on American Idol and Live with Kelly and Ryan, seemed like the obvious choice for the job. However, the transition was not without its challenges. Sajak was beloved by fans, and any new host would have to deal with the inevitable comparisons. The stakes were high, and the spotlight was intense.
When Seacrest first took the stage, he knew that he had big shoes to fill. He wasn’t just replacing a host; he was taking over an institution. Despite his immense popularity in other realms of television, he understood that Wheel of Fortune fans had a deep connection to Sajak, and winning them over would require more than just delivering the lines. Seacrest needed to bring something fresh while respecting the history and legacy of the show.
